The Health and Environmental Benefits of Switching from Gas to Induction Cooktops

For decades, the gas flame was considered the hallmark of the professional kitchen, a symbol of heat and precision. However, a significant shift is underway in home design and residential policy. As we gain a deeper understanding of indoor air quality and the long-term impacts of fossil fuel combustion, the kitchen is undergoing a quiet revolution: the transition from gas to induction.

Induction cooking uses electromagnetic energy to heat cookware directly, rather than heating the air around a vessel with a flame. This seemingly simple technological shift carries profound implications for both family health and the broader environmental landscape.
